Need to update Etherpad once more. This will be much smaller, though, and is mainly to pull in some new upstream features (delete public pads!) and some Mozilla-specific fixes (don't tell people to email us on problems, link them the itrequest Bugzilla form instead). To do this, we should remove the Etherpad RPM and replace it with a git checkout of the repo I created for this: git://github.com/superawesome/pad.git https://github.com/superawesome/pad This repo is basically just a fork of the upstream Etherpad github repo, with Mozilla-specific fixes merged in. The mana documentation should be updated to reflect how this works. Also, I have checked in a shell script to puppet, which should ultimately be useful for pulling and deploying a new version of Etherpad from this git repo. Needs some refinement, but it's a start. There is another project on the horizon to add BrowserID support to Etherpad. When that gets underway, this git repo may move to the main mozilla github account... or some similar place where webdev can more easily maintain it.
